FAWM 2009 - 9 new songs
So this was my 4th year participating in February Album Writing Month (FAWM). The idea is to write and record 14 songs duing February–basically one song every other day. This year I only got 9 songs but I think there are some really great ones that you may hear Westerly playing in the future.
